Bayelsa ministerial nominee: Jonathan dismisses lobbying allegation, blames low profile politicians

From Femi Folaranmi, Yenagoa

Former President Goodluck Jonathan has described as “false, malicious, preposterous and unnecessary” reports attributed to a group, Bayelsa APC Elders Council, claiming that he was lobbying the President, Bola Ahmed Tinubu to nominate a Minister designate from the state.

Jonathan in a statement by his Special Adviser, Ikechukwu Eze while noting that he would have ignored the claims of the “shadowy characters” behind the report stated that genuine concerns raised by Nigerians on the dangers of innocent Nigerians believing the report has made him to categorically declared that the claims are untrue.

According to him, those behind the report may have wrongly misinterpreted the visit to Aso- Rock in respect of President Tinubu’s new role as ECOWAS Chairman, as lobbying for ministerial slots.

He stated that no amount of falsehood by ignorant politicians would diminish the status of President Jonathan who has been acknowledged across the world as a selfless and exemplary leader.

The statement read in part:

“We state without equivocation that the authors of the hackery who are quick to spin such unfounded narrative could neither provide any clarification on the nature of the alleged consultations nor name the beneficiary of the envisaged nomination. We can only guess that a handful of faltering low-profile politicians might have wrongly misinterpreted Jonathan’s recent visit to the Presidential Villa in Abuja, even when the former President, who is ECOWAS mediator in Mali and Chairman of ECOWAS Council of the Wise, clearly explained that he had gone to brief President Bola Tinubu, who has just been elected as the Chairman of the Authority of ECOWAS Heads of State and Government, on the recent developments in the sub-region.
